Summary: The High Court of Gujarat suspended the sentence in a Negotiable Instruments Act Section 138 conviction case and granted bail to applicant Ketankumar Mohanlal Patel pending disposal of the revision application. The applicant was released on bail with a personal bond of Rs. 10,000 and surety of like amount, subject to conditions including pursuing the matter diligently and not leaving India without court permission.
